1 MD Program, 2 Tracks

AUC’s global footprint allows eligible Canadian medical students abroad to begin their journey to become a physician on our campus in Sint Maarten or in the United Kingdom through our partnership with the University of Central Lancashire (UCLan). 

Our internationally recognized program offers a rigorous education model taught by expert faculty, designed to develop an in-depth understanding of different healthcare systems and patient populations which makes it one of the esteemed options for medical schools abroad for Canadian students. Grounded in authentic clinical case-based teaching, AUC’s curriculum embodies a spiral learning approach (study, learn, apply, then repeat), which offers a deeper understanding of content and practice—and mimics how our students will ultimately engage with patients as physicians.

Nearly 10% of AUC’s student body is made up of Canadian students.  Applicants can upload their OMSAS application to apply to AUC.
